Buying Guide – How to Choose the Right K‑Beauty Products
Sunscreens
Korean sunscreens are known for their lightweight textures and high SPF ratings. When shopping, look for SPF 50+ broad‑spectrum coverage to protect against both UVA and UVB rays. Many formulas include added skincare benefits like rice extract, probiotics, or hyaluronic acid, making them suitable for daily wear under makeup. If you have sensitive skin, opt for mineral sunscreens with zinc oxide or titanium dioxide, while oily skin types may prefer gel‑based sunscreens that absorb quickly.
Serums
Serums are concentrated treatments designed to target specific concerns. In 2026, the most popular K‑Beauty serums in the UK feature vitamin C for brightening, ginseng for revitalization, and retinal or peptides for anti‑aging. Layering serums is common — for example, using vitamin C in the morning and retinal at night. Always check ingredient lists and start with one active serum before combining multiple products to avoid irritation.
Moisturizers
Moisturizers lock in hydration and strengthen the skin barrier. Gel creams and jelly moisturizers are ideal for oily or combination skin, while richer collagen or snail mucin creams are better for dry or mature skin. UK shoppers often switch textures seasonally — lighter gels in summer, heavier creams in winter. Look for moisturizers with ceramides or niacinamide if you want barrier repair and redness reduction.

Are Korean sunscreens better than UK brands?
Korean sunscreens are highly regarded because they combine high SPF ratings with lightweight, non‑greasy textures. Unlike many traditional UK sunscreens, K‑Beauty formulas often include skincare benefits such as probiotics, rice extract, or hyaluronic acid. This makes them suitable for daily wear under makeup, which is why they’ve become so popular among UK consumers. While UK brands are improving, Korean sunscreens are often praised for their innovation and affordability, making them a strong choice for everyday protection.

How do I choose the right K‑Beauty moisturizer for my skin type?
The key is to match the texture of the moisturizer to your skin’s needs. Gel creams and jelly moisturizers are ideal for oily or combination skin because they hydrate without clogging pores. Richer collagen creams or snail mucin formulas are better for dry or mature skin, offering deep hydration and elasticity. UK winters can be harsh, so many shoppers switch to heavier creams during colder months and lighter gels in summer. Reading product reviews and checking ingredient lists can help you pick the right fit.
Why is K‑Beauty so popular in the UK?
K‑Beauty’s popularity in the UK comes down to three factors: affordability, innovation, and social media influence. Korean brands often deliver high‑quality skincare at lower prices than luxury Western brands. They also innovate quickly, introducing new textures, ingredients, and packaging that appeal to younger audiences. TikTok and Instagram have amplified this trend, with viral videos showcasing products like COSRX snail essence or Medicube pore pads. As a result, UK consumers see K‑Beauty as both effective and trendy.
